1. Overview of Pakistan’s Job Market

Pakistan’s employment landscape is divided into Government Jobs and Private Jobs, each with its own advantages.

Government Jobs Offer:

  • Fixed working hours
  • Job security
  • Pension benefits
  • Long-term career stability
  • Allowances (medical, fuel, residence)

Private Jobs Offer:

  • Higher salary potential
  • Fast career growth
  • Skill-based hiring
  • Modern work environment
  • Performance bonuses

Knowing what each sector offers helps you choose what aligns with your career goals.


2. Latest Government Vacancies in Pakistan

Government departments frequently announce vacancies for candidates across the country. These opportunities are available for matric pass candidates to master’s degree holders.

Here are some of the most recent and in-demand government job categories.


a. Federal Government Jobs

Federal departments like FIA, FBR, Ministry of Defence, and NAB often recruit for positions such as:

  • Assistant Directors
  • Stenotypists
  • Clerks
  • Inspectors
  • Constables
  • Data Entry Operators

Eligibility:

  • Education: Intermediate to Master’s
  • Age limit: 18–30 years
  • Domicile: Any province
  • Skills: Typing speed, computer literacy (varies by position)

Salary Range: PKR 40,000–150,000+


b. Provincial Government Jobs (PPSC, KPPSC, SPSC)

Provincial Public Service Commissions announce jobs for:

  • Teachers
  • Lecturers
  • Health Officers
  • Revenue Staff
  • Assistant Directors
  • Judiciary-related positions

Why in demand?
These jobs offer competitive salaries, promotions, and excellent annual increments.

Salary Range: PKR 45,000–200,000


c. Police and Law Enforcement Vacancies

Each province opens recruitment for:

  • Police Constables
  • ASI, SI, Inspector Posts
  • Traffic Wardens
  • Motorway Police Staff
  • Special Protection Unit (SPU)

Requirements:

  • Physical fitness test
  • Matric to Bachelor’s
  • Age limit varies by province

Salary Range: PKR 35,000–120,000


d. Defence Forces (Army, Navy, Air Force)

The Pakistan Army, Navy, and PAF offer some of the most prestigious jobs.

Available Positions:

  • Soldiers (Sipahi)
  • Sailors/Airmen
  • Officers through PMA Long Course
  • Short Service Commission
  • Civilian jobs (Clerks, Technicians)

Eligibility:

  • Matric to Master’s depending on post
  • Strict physical standards
  • Age: 17–30 years

Salary Range: PKR 30,000–180,000+


3. Latest Private Company Jobs Explained

The private sector continues to grow, especially in IT, telecom, banking, real estate, and corporate industries.

Below are the main categories of private jobs currently trending in Pakistan.


a. Banking Sector Jobs

Banks such as HBL, UBL, MCB, ABL, and Meezan Bank regularly hire fresh graduates.

Common Posts:

  • Cash Officers
  • MTO (Management Trainee Officers)
  • Customer Service Officers
  • Relationship Managers

Eligibility:

  • Bachelor’s or Master’s degree
  • Good communication skills
  • Basic computer literacy

Salary Range: PKR 40,000–140,000


b. Information Technology & Software Jobs

IT remains one of the fastest-growing fields in the country.

Popular Roles:

  • Web & App Developers
  • SEO Experts
  • Digital Marketers
  • Graphic Designers
  • Data Analysts
  • Cybersecurity Specialists

Eligibility:

  • Relevant degree or certification
  • Portfolio of skills/projects

Salary Range: PKR 60,000–300,000+


c. Telecom & Corporate Company Jobs

Companies like Jazz, Zong, PTCL, Telenor, Daraz, and NestlΓ© often recruit for:

  • Sales Executives
  • HR Officers
  • Admin Officers
  • Operation Assistants
  • Business Development Officers

Salary Range: PKR 35,000–180,000


d. E-Commerce and Online Jobs

With platforms like Amazon, Daraz, Upwork, and Fiverr, online jobs have become very popular.

Trending Posts:

  • Virtual Assistants
  • Content Writers
  • Social Media Managers
  • Amazon FBA Specialists

Salary Range: PKR 40,000–250,000

5. How to Apply for These Jobs

Government Jobs Application Process

  1. Visit the official portals:
    • FPSC, PPSC, KPPSC, SPSC
    • Join Pak Army, Navy, Air Force
  2. Read the advertisement carefully.
  3. Fill out the online form.
  4. Pay challan fee (if required).
  5. Prepare for written tests & interviews.

Private Jobs Application Process

  1. Search vacancies at:
    • Rozee.pk
    • LinkedIn
    • Indeed
    • Company websites
  2. Submit your CV or apply through email.
  3. Prepare for interviews & assessments.
